The Current State of the Oil and Gas Industry

The global oil and gas sector remains one of the largest contributors to energy production worldwide, powering industries, transportation, and electricity grids. Despite ongoing efforts to develop renewable energy sources, fossil fuels continue to provide over 50% of the world’s energy needs. However, volatility in supply and pricing, geopolitical tensions, and environmental concerns are all reshaping the industry’s trajectory.

Recent Market Trends

In recent years, oil prices have experienced significant swings due to various factors such as the COVID-19 pandemic’s impact on demand, decisions by the Organization of the Petroleum Exporting Countries (OPEC), and shifting US energy policies. For example, oil prices dropped dramatically in early 2020 as global lockdowns curtailed travel and industrial activity, only to rebound as economies reopened. Natural gas markets have also been highly dynamic, influenced by weather patterns and policy changes, especially in Europe and Asia.

Political Factors Shaping the Oil and Gas Outlook

Energy Policy Shifts and Regulation

Governments worldwide are increasingly adopting policies aimed at reducing carbon emissions, promoting clean energy, and phasing out fossil fuel subsidies. The United States, under recent administrations, has promoted a mixed approach—supporting domestic oil and gas development while also committing to ambitious climate goals. European Union nations have pushed forward with their Green Deal, aiming for climate neutrality by 2050, which includes stringent regulations on fossil fuel usage.

Such regulatory frameworks lead to uncertainty in the oil and gas sector but also push companies to innovate, diversify, and invest in cleaner technologies like carbon capture and hydrogen fuels. For instance, BP and Shell have announced multi-billion-dollar investments in renewable energy alongside traditional oil and gas operations.

Geopolitical Tensions and Global Supply

Geopolitical conflicts and alliances significantly impact oil supply security and pricing. The Middle East remains a critical hotspot due to its vast reserves and influence within OPEC. Recent disruptions, such as tensions between Iran and Saudi Arabia or conflicts in Libya, can tighten supplies and drive prices upward.

Additionally, sanctions targeting countries like Russia have reshaped global energy trade flows. Europe’s movement away from Russian gas imports following the Ukraine conflict has accelerated the search for alternative suppliers and energy sources, affecting global gas markets and pricing.

Economic Factors Influencing the Oil and Gas Sector

Economic growth rates, technological advances, and investment trends heavily influence the oil and gas outlook. Emerging economies like India and China are expected to drive a significant portion of future energy demand, particularly in transportation and industrial sectors.

Investment and Financing Challenges

The oil and gas industry requires massive capital investments to explore, produce, and refine resources. However, rising concerns about climate risk have led many institutional investors and banks to scrutinize or limit funding for new fossil fuel projects. This trend forces companies to balance short-term production goals with long-term sustainability strategies.

For example, ExxonMobil and Chevron have faced pressure from shareholders to align their business models with climate goals while maintaining competitiveness. This has prompted greater emphasis on efficiency improvements and renewables integration.

Technological Innovation and Efficiency Gains

Advancements in drilling techniques, such as horizontal drilling and hydraulic fracturing, have revolutionized oil and gas extraction, particularly in the United States. These technologies unlocked shale resources, transforming the US into one of the world’s top producers.

Meanwhile, digitalization and automation improve operational efficiency and reduce costs. Technologies such as AI-driven predictive maintenance and real-time monitoring help companies manage assets better, optimize output, and reduce environmental impacts.

The Environmental Dimension and Energy Transition

Environmental concerns are central to the oil and gas outlook as the world grapples with climate change and pollution. Governments, consumers, and activists increasingly demand cleaner energy solutions and transparency about companies’ environmental footprints.

Carbon Emissions and Regulatory Pressure

Oil and gas operations are significant sources of greenhouse gas emissions. Methane leaks from natural gas infrastructure, flaring of excess gas, and carbon dioxide released during combustion all contribute to climate change. In response, many governments are implementing stricter emissions targets and requiring companies to measure and reduce their carbon footprints.

For example, the recent US Inflation Reduction Act includes incentives for reducing methane emissions and boosting clean energy development. Similarly, international forums like COP26 have reinforced commitments to cut fossil fuel subsidies and accelerate renewable adoption.

Transition to Renewable Energy and Alternative Fuels

The global push for decarbonization is fostering growth in renewable energy sectors like wind, solar, and biofuels. Oil and gas companies are increasingly investing in these areas to diversify their portfolios and prepare for a low-carbon future.

Hydrogen, especially “green hydrogen” produced from renewable electricity, is gaining attention as a potential clean fuel for industries and heavy transport. For example, Shell has launched pilot projects integrating hydrogen production with existing natural gas infrastructure.

Practical Examples: How Countries Are Shaping Their Oil and Gas Futures

Consider Norway, which combines robust oil and gas production with aggressive investments in offshore wind and carbon capture technology. The government manages oil revenues through a sovereign wealth fund that supports sustainable development.

In contrast, Saudi Arabia continues to leverage its oil wealth while promoting Vision 2030, which includes diversifying its economy and investing in renewable energy projects like the NEOM city development.

In North America, Canada’s oil sands industry faces pressure from environmental policies but is simultaneously exploring technologies to reduce emissions and expand clean energy integration.

Frequently Asked Questions

What is driving recent volatility in oil and gas prices?

Price volatility stems from supply-demand imbalances caused by factors such as geopolitical conflicts, OPEC production decisions, pandemic-related disruptions, and shifts in energy policies. Additionally, economic growth rates and weather patterns can influence demand fluctuations.

How are political decisions impacting the future of oil and gas?

Governments enact regulations, subsidies, and international agreements that either support or restrict fossil fuel development. Climate goals lead to stricter emissions standards and promote renewables, while geopolitical tensions can affect supply security and trade flows.

What role does technology play in the oil and gas industry?

Technological advancements enhance extraction efficiency, reduce costs, improve safety, and decrease environmental impact. Innovations like hydraulic fracturing unlocked shale resources, while digital tools optimize asset management and emissions monitoring.

How is the energy transition affecting oil and gas companies?

Many companies are diversifying into renewable energy and cleaner fuels to align with climate commitments and investor expectations. They are adopting strategies to reduce carbon footprints, investing in carbon capture, and exploring hydrogen and biofuels.

Can oil and gas remain relevant in a renewable future?

Yes. While renewables grow, oil and gas are expected to remain integral for decades, especially in sectors like transportation and manufacturing. The key is integrating cleaner technologies and managing emissions responsibly to balance energy needs with sustainability.
